Bospar principal Curtis Sparrer earns a 2025 PRNEWS People of the Year award in The Agency CEOs category

SAN FRANCISCO – Aug. 21 2025 – Bospar, the “politely pushy” PR and marketing firm that puts health and tech companies on the map, today announced that Bospar Principal Curtis Sparrer has been named a 2025 PRNEWS People of the Year honoree in The Agency CEOs category. 

The PRNEWS People of the Year Awards shine a spotlight on the visionary leaders who have pushed boundaries, driven change and redefined the PR industry with creativity, innovation and strategic brilliance. The PRNEWS People of the Year award recipients will be honored at the 2025 Platinum Awards Gala on Oct. 7 in New York City.

“I don’t deserve this recognition; my colleagues at Bospar do,” said Sparrer. “Their creativity and drive inspire us to push boundaries every day. It’s because of them that Bospar has become the most awarded PR agency on a person-by-person basis. That’s proof that pound for pound, no one in the industry delivers award-winning results like we do.”

About Bospar

Bospar is the award-winning “politely pushy” tech and health public relations and marketing agency. The firm, which launched in 2015, provides clients with national support thanks to its distributed agency model. Bospar’s staff includes marketing and PR experts and veteran journalists from top-tier tech and business media. The agency’s strategic and creative thinkers excel in earned and social media, analyst and investor relations, content creation and placement, and public affairs. Leaders from brands – including Alkermes, Standigm, Marqeta, Snowflake and Unisys – trust Bospar to drive category leadership for disruptive technologies and solutions.
